Update: Friday
Police are thanking the public for tips that led them to a Niagara Falls hotel yesterday, where they arrested Johnathan Wade, charging him with what's listed below.
He has a bail hearing today.
Update: Thursday
Police are warning the public to be the lookout for 35-year old Johnathan Wade of Niagara Falls, wanted in connection to this shooting.
They found an imitation gun and ammo in the hotel room, which they believe was used.
Police say the suspect is wanted for:
- Assault with a Weapon
- Careless Use of a Firearm
- Pointing a Firearm
- Possession of a Weapon for a Dangerous Purpose
- Discharge Firearm with Intent
- Fail to Comply with Release Order x 2
- Fail to Comply with Prohibition Order
- Disobey Court Order
Police say he is 5'10, 200lbs, with a shaved head, and fled the scene in a blue SUV, shirtless, wearing black pants and dark shoes.
Police add if anyone in the Queen Street and Zimmerman Avenue area have video footage that can help find this suspect, call them.
Original Story:
Police say a man has been shot in Niagara Falls.
They were called this morning to the Queen Street and Zimmerman Avenue area.
The man has been taken to an out of region hospital, his injuries have been determined to be non life-threatening.
Police have not made any arrests, nor found a weapon.
The public is being asked to avoid the area.
